Questions & Answers

Q: What is the growth potential for Starbucks?

Starbucks has shown consistent revenue and same-store sales growth, with their fourth-quarter revenue up 11%. They also have a strong user base for their loyalty program, indicating potential for further growth.

Q: How has Google's stock performed recently?

Google's stock has been on a rise, increasing from $130 to $141 per share in just six days. Their revenue growth has primarily come from YouTube ads and search.

Q: What improvements has Cisco made in its supply chain?

Cisco has resolved its supply chain issues and has seen a substantial increase in net income and free cash flow. They have a good return on invested capital and a manageable debt level.

Q: Why is Southwest Airlines paying a dividend?

Despite currently low-profit margins due to the pandemic, Southwest Airlines has a history of strong profit margins. The dividend payout is considered unnecessary by some, who suggest share buybacks instead.

Q: What are the financials of American Express?

American Express has a high gross margin and decent return on equity. They have a single-digit price-to-free-cash-flow ratio and solid financials overall, although there are concerns about increasing credit losses.
